Everything I need to know about
life, I learned from Noah's Ark
One: Don't miss the boat.
Two: Remember that we are all
in the same boat.
Three: Plan ahead. It wasn't
raining when Noah built the Ark.
Four: Stay fit. When you're
600 years old, someone may ask you to
do something really big.
Five: Don't listen to critics;
just get on with the job that needs
to be done.
Six: Build your future on high
ground.
Seven: For safety's sake, travel
in pairs.
Eight: Speed isn't always an
advantage. The snails were on board
with the cheetahs.
Nine: When you're stressed,
float a while.
Ten: Remember, the Ark was
built by amateurs; the Titanic by professionals.
Eleven: No matter the storm,
when you are with God, there's always
a rainbow waiting...
